What is an AI data labeling internship?

An AI Data Labeling Internship is a temporary position where interns assist in preparing datasets for machine learning models by accurately annotating, categorizing, or tagging data such as images, text, or audio. Interns learn about the fundamentals of artificial intelligence and the importance of high-quality labeled data in training algorithms. This role is ideal for students or recent graduates interested in AI, data science, or related fields, and provides hands-on experience with data preparation and quality assurance processes.

What are some common challenges faced during an AI data labeling internship, and how can I overcome them?

As an AI Data Labeling intern, you may encounter challenges such as maintaining high accuracy while labeling large volumes of data, understanding complex labeling guidelines, and managing repetitive tasks without losing focus. To overcome these, it's helpful to regularly review the instructions, seek feedback from your team lead, and use productivity techniques to stay engaged. Collaborating with other interns and attending team meetings can also provide valuable insights and help you address uncertainties quickly.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an AI data labeling intern?

To thrive as an AI Data Labeling Intern, you need attention to detail, basic data analysis skills, and familiarity with data annotation concepts, often supported by a background in computer science or related fields. Experience using annotation platforms, spreadsheets, and sometimes specific labeling software is common, though formal certifications are not usually required. Strong communication, time management, and the ability to follow detailed guidelines set high performers apart in this role. These skills ensure accurate, high-quality data sets that are essential for training reliable AI models.

Description Summary:        

The Senior Quality Engineer - Data & AI sits at the intersection of data engineering, machine learning product delivery, and quality assurance. This role is responsible for validating AI-powered and data-driven features across M3's hospitality accounting platform, with primary ownership of quality for the Data & AI team's active products.

Unlike traditional QE roles focused on deterministic software, this position requires quality thinking applied to systems that produce probabilistic outputs - where "passing" is defined by accuracy thresholds, not binary correctness. The right candidate understands how AI products fail differently and is motivated to build the testing practice that prevents those failures from reaching customers.

This is an individual contributor role with significant cross-functional responsibility, including collaboration with Engineering, Product, Data, and external contractor teams.

Essential Duties:

The duties listed below are the essential functions of this position, and they may change as the needs of the company demand. All associates are expected to do what is necessary to get the work done and to cooperate fully with their supervisor's requests for additional or altered duties. 

  • Design and execute test strategies for AI/ML-enabled features; define acceptance thresholds (precision, recall, F1) in partnership with Engineering and Product.
  • Validate AI-generated outputs - mappings, anomaly flags, LLM summaries - against domain-grounded acceptance criteria; build regression suites to detect concept drift, label drift, and feature degradation.
  • Evaluate LLM outputs for accuracy, hallucination, and format compliance; build prompt regression test suites to catch behavior changes when model versions or system prompts are updated.
  • Write data validation logic in Python or SQL against tables across Bronze, Silver, and Gold layers; design and automate data contract tests covering schema, null rates, referential integrity, and row counts.
  • Implement automated validation checkpoints in Databricks pipelines; apply statistical testing methods to pipeline output validation.
  • Define and instrument production monitoring checks for model performance: alert thresholds, confidence degradation, and data drift.
  • Perform functional, regression, integration, and exploratory testing across releases, enhancements, and defect fixes using manual and automated approaches.
  • Design, develop, maintain, and execute automated test scripts using frameworks such as Katalon and Playwright; support CI/CD quality gates.
  • Develop and execute test cases for ETL processes, data warehouse workflows, and API validation.
  • Review application logs and monitoring tools to identify and track defects; coordinate builds, deployments, and software migrations for planned releases and hotfixes.
  • Maintain and utilize testing tools including Azure DevOps, SQL Server, Postman/Swagger/SoapUI, and automation frameworks.
  • Participate in Agile ceremonies; collaborate with Product, Engineering, Data, and external contractor teams to ensure comprehensive coverage and aligned acceptance criteria.
  • Communicate quality risks early and in writing; develop and maintain a QE runbook for AI/ML products.
